jQuery.form.js中文API详解:简化AJAX表单提交与事件处理
5星 · 超过95%的资源 需积分: 10 146 浏览量
更新于2024-09-20
1
收藏 51KB DOC 举报
jQuery.form.js是一个强大的JavaScript插件,用于简化表单数据的处理和异步提交,使得开发者能够方便地实现AJAX功能,提高用户体验。该插件的核心功能是`ajaxForm`方法,它提供了一种优雅的方式来集成表单提交与后台交互。
`ajaxForm`方法是jQuery.form.js的核心组件,它负责设置并监听表单相关的事件,确保当表单被用户提交时,数据可以被正确地发送到服务器,并且在提交过程中处理可能出现的各种情况。使用`ajaxForm`时,通常会在`$(document).ready`函数中调用,这样确保DOM加载完成后再进行相关操作。
这个方法接受两种参数形式:
1. 回调函数:这是一个可选参数,当你需要自定义表单提交过程中的某些逻辑或者获取提交结果时,可以传递一个函数作为回调。回调函数会在表单成功提交、失败或者遇到错误时被触发,接收两个参数:`data`(提交的数据)和`jqXHR`(XMLHttpRequest对象),允许开发者根据具体需求定制响应。
2. Options对象:这也是一个可选参数,可以用来配置`ajaxForm`的行为。这个对象可以包含以下选项:
- `beforeSubmit`: 提交前的预处理函数,用于检查表单是否合法或执行其他操作。
- `success`: 表单提交成功的处理函数,返回服务器响应后执行。
- `complete`: 表单提交完成后的回调,无论成功与否都会触发。
- `dataType`: 指定预期的服务器响应类型,如JSON、HTML等。
- `timeout`: 如果请求超时的毫秒数。
- `error`: 发生错误时的处理函数。
通过`ajaxForm`方法,你可以避免在每个表单元素上手动绑定事件监听器,简化代码并提高维护性。同时,由于异步特性,用户可以在提交表单后立即继续页面交互,不会阻塞页面渲染,提升了网站的响应性能。
jQuery.form.js的`ajaxForm`方法是前端开发人员在处理需要异步数据交互的表单提交时的强大工具,它提供了一个易于使用的接口来管理复杂的表单行为,并且可以根据项目需求进行灵活定制。熟练掌握这个插件有助于提升开发效率和用户体验。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2012-04-21 上传
2017-12-15 上传
2011-10-29 上传
2011-06-04 上传
2012-06-12 上传
2012-11-20 上传
夜中雨滴
- 粉丝: 265
- 资源: 131
最新资源
- 俄罗斯RTSD数据集实现交通标志实时检测
- 易语言开发的文件批量改名工具使用Ex_Dui美化界面
- 爱心援助动态网页教程:前端开发实战指南
- 复旦微电子数字电路课件4章同步时序电路详解
- Dylan Manley的编程投资组合登录页面设计介绍
- Python实现H3K4me3与H3K27ac表观遗传标记域长度分析
- 易语言开源播放器项目:简易界面与强大的音频支持
- 介绍rxtx2.2全系统环境下的Java版本使用
- ZStack-CC2530 半开源协议栈使用与安装指南
- 易语言实现的八斗平台与淘宝评论采集软件开发
- Christiano响应式网站项目设计与技术特点
- QT图形框架中QGraphicRectItem的插入与缩放技术
- 组合逻辑电路深入解析与习题教程
- Vue+ECharts实现中国地图3D展示与交互功能
- MiSTer_MAME_SCRIPTS:自动下载MAME与HBMAME脚本指南
- 前端技术精髓:构建响应式盆栽展示网站